《virtualbox完全学习手册》之shared folder功能详解04-凯发app官方网站

凯发app官方网站-凯发k8官网下载客户端中心 | | 凯发app官方网站-凯发k8官网下载客户端中心
  • 博客访问: 712463
  • 博文数量: 71
  • 博客积分: 4328
  • 博客等级: 上校
  • 技术积分: 2052
  • 用 户 组: 普通用户
  • 注册时间: 2012-06-27 21:14
文章存档

2015年(1)

2013年(25)

2012年(45)

相关博文
  • ·
  • ·
  • ·
  • ·
  • ·
  • ·
  • ·
  • ·
  • ·
  • ·

分类: 虚拟化

2012-11-09 12:59:36

2.shared folders:”shared folders“一般也叫做“共享文件夹”,是指将物理机的资料通过特殊通信管道直接分享(映射)到虚拟机。需要特别强调的是virtualbox未提供”通过直接拖拽的方式共享物理机数据到虚拟机“。在”vmware workstation“中提供类似的功能叫做”shared folder“且”vmware workstation“是支持”通过直接拖拽的方式共享物理机数据到虚拟机“的。

virtualbox中,提供两种形式的“shared folders”:transientpermanent

transient表示临时性的共享,比如共享只在vm加电运行期间有实际效果,而在虚拟机关闭的情况下,virtualbox会自动关闭共享;permanent表示永久性的共享,不管虚拟机处在何种状态,共享都是一直存在的,除非我们手动关闭。

需要注意第一点是:virtualbox中的“shared folders”在windows中支持以快捷方式存在的目录,而在linux发行版中也是支持以快捷方式存在的目录的。

需要注意的第二点是:“shared folders”提供物理机和虚拟机之间的沟通是通过一个特别的管道实现的,如果vmwindows系统,那么此管道我们称之为“pseudo-network redirector”;如果vmlinux系统,那么此管道我们称之为“virtual file system”。这也是为什么我们要实现“shared folders”功能,需要在vm中安装“guest additions”的原因。

【实验十】shared folders也能这样玩! for windows

如果我们共享的物理机文件夹没有在虚拟机中自动挂载,那么我们可以采取手动的方式进行挂载。不管是gui的方式还是cli的方式都是可行的。

step 1:我们打开“virtualbox manager”,在虚拟机列表框中选择一台windows系统的vm,然后配置好其”共享文件夹“功能,接着加电启动这台vm,在其【开始】--->【运行】对话框中输入【cmd】,打开cmd命令行工具,在其上输入对应的dos命令:”net use x: \\vboxsrv\movie“或””net use x: \\vboxsvr\movie““即可把共享文件夹映射到虚拟机中;

step 2:我们打开“virtualbox manager”,在虚拟机列表框中选择一台windows系统的vm,然后配置好其”共享文件夹“功能,接着加电启动这台vm,在其【开始】--->【运行】对话框中输入unc路径\\vboxsrv\,在弹出的共享文件夹列表中,我们选择一个文件夹,然后点击右键,选择【映射网络驱动器】即可把共享文件夹映射到虚拟机中。

wps_clip_image-19581

step 3:不管是通过gui界面还是cli界面vm都可以随时通过”pseudo-network redirector“管道随时访问物理机共享的文件夹资源。

 

更加详细的内容,敬请期待本人即将上市的呕心力作 《virtualbox完全学习手册》。

姜皓,网络id 小耗子老师,精通linux服务器管理、windows server 服务器管理、cisco路由器管理、虚拟化(vmware workstation、vsphere、virtualbox)等内容。
现就职于西北某国企。

阅读(3349)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~
")); function link(t){ var href= $(t).attr('href'); href ="?url=" encodeuricomponent(location.href); $(t).attr('href',href); //setcookie("returnouturl", location.href, 60, "/"); }
网站地图